KFC Fakeaway 🍗
This recipe will give you tasty, crispy, juicy chicken, without needing to fry anything! It’s so easy, you’ll love it! LETS GO!
Ingredients
CHICKEN
1KG chicken (mix of breast, thigh & drumsticks)
75g plain flour
1 tsp garlic salt
Big tsp smoked paprika
1 tsp dried thyme
Salt & pepper
Doritos (optional)
Oil
MARINADE
250ml low-fat buttermilk
1 tbsp light soy sauce
1 tsp salt
1/2 tsp cayenne pepper
1/2 tsp dried thyme
1/2 tsp dried sage
1/2 tsp dried oregano
1/2 tsp pepper
GRAVY
4 tbsp flora light
4 tbsp plain flour
500ml boiling water
1 beef stock cube
1 chicken stock cube
3 tbsp plain flour
1/4 tsp garlic powder
Salt and pepper
Method
Trim any fat and rank bits from the chicken. To make the popcorn chicken, just chop breasts into small bite-size bits.

Place the chicken into a bowl. And add all the marinade ingredients! (I told you this would be easy!) mix and combine everything together. Let it sit overnight, or a minimum of 4 hours.

Now the fun bit! Stick the oven up to 240 Celsius. Get a large baking tray ready, and line it with greaseproof.

Add your flour to a bowl, with all the seasoning. Dip your marinaded chicken into the seasoned flour. Place SKIN SIDE DOWN on the greaseproof paper. Repeat with all the chicken.

OPTIONAL STEP - crush Doritos up as fine as you can, and coat the chicken with Doritos.

Spray with oil, and put it in the oven. BE SURE TO SLIDE IT INTO THE TOP SHELF. Cook it for 25-30 minutes. I’d recommend getting a thermometer for chicken (it always scares me that I’ll undercook it!) DONE!
GRAVY
Melt the butter in a pan. Once melted, add your flour. Whisk it together until it’s a paste (looks like scrambled egg almost)
Mix your stock cubes with the water. Slowly pour into your paste. Keep whisking it. Once the stock is added, season with salt, pepper, and garlic salt.
Run it through a sieve, and then you get your tasty, thick gravy. Perfect for that, finger lickin’ chicken. Serves 4 people at 385 calories per person! I KNOW!!
